This anthology pulls together six stories from science fiction's golden era. Keith Laumer contributes four tales including "The Star-Sent Knaves," where protagonists face alien infiltrators, and "The Long Remembered Thunder," which explores the aftermath of catastrophic events. His "The Night of the Trolls" presents survivors navigating a transformed world, while "The Frozen Planet" drops characters onto an ice-bound alien world. Kurt Vonnegut adds two contributions: "The Big Trip Yonder" follows characters confronting mortality and meaning, and "2 B R 0 2 B" depicts a society where death becomes a managed commodity. Each story captures the period's focus on technological change and human adaptation. The collection showcases both authors' ability to blend speculative concepts with character-driven narratives, examining how people respond when familiar rules no longer apply.
